separating out; differentiating; sorting
The act of separating or distinguishing items, often used in contexts like sorting goods, differentiating qualities, or dividing outputs.
The work of sorting the products took time.
This machine can sort by size.
Compound of 出し (dashi, continuative form of 出す 'to put out') and 分け (wake, continuative form of 分ける 'to divide/separate').
